Fallout 3 DLC Dated

14 Jan, 2009, 11:31 am IST | by Avinash Bali |

Operation Anchorage, the PC and Xbox 360 exclusive downloadable content for Fallout 3 will be available from the 27th of January 2009 for 800 Microsoft Points.


Operation: Anchorage adds a military simulation mission that whisks players back to a very different pre-nuclear wasteland world where Chinese invaders need repelling. Adventurers will fit into a tightly run special ops team and have to survive within the rules of the training program.

There's around five hours of content on offer, plus a new perk and plenty of unique items and weapons to collect.

Operation: Anchorage will be followed by The Pitt in February and Broken Steel in March. The former adds an industrial raider town to investigate, while the latter recruits players into the Brotherhood of Steel and bumps the level cap up to 30. Broken Steel can be played after finishing the main Fallout 3 campaign.
